1988 1st US Edition Rare uncorrected proof. Grey card wrappers, with titles printed in black.

A BRIEF HISTORY OF TIME: FROM THE BIG BANG TO BLACK HOLES
By Stephen Hawking

Author Bio: Stephen William Hawking CH CBE FRS FRSA (8 January 1942 – 14 March 2018) was an English theoretical physicist, cosmologist, and author who, at the time of his death, was director of research at the Centre for Theoretical Cosmology at the University of Cambridge. Between 1979 and 2009, he was the Lucasian Professor of Mathematics at the University of Cambridge, widely viewed as one of the most prestigious academic posts in the world.

Synopsis: ADVANCE UNCORRECTED PROOF - First US Edition 187 PAGES, illustrations omitted Other copies on the market for c£1,000 to £1,750 The British physicist's best-known work, a popular science book on cosmology that has sold more than 10 million copies. An uncommon advance, lacking the both text of Carl Sagan's introduction (though he is credited on the title page), and Ron Miller's proposed illustrations.
